Hey!! I've been over weight by like a few stone for a few years now, im loucky i dont look like a complete blob, ive got a good shape on me but i am trying to shift the weight for my new healty living plan!!!
I've joined a gym and have done 5 days this week, each one hour sessions.
I'm looking for some advice on whether this is a good amount to be doind in terms of weight loss and toning up, i really don't want to beef out, no body building or huge muscles, just nice normal-ness for me really.
I do 10 mins on the tread mill. 10 on the bicycle thing. 10 on the air walker thing, 5 mins on the rowing machine, i do the peck deck thing, the pully down bar thing, and some dumbell things for my obliques and bi/triceps, and then about 60-70 sit ups. i would very much like some easy bum exercises. and also, are the ones im already doing ok for weight loss and light toning. any other advice on weight loss please. no yoyo diet tips tho thanks. cheers x


you sound like your off to a good start. you should also try matching your calorie defiency (cutting out calories from your diet) from exercising with your intake...For example if you workout for a hour daily and burn 150 calories you take that 150 calories out of your diet too, that way you have a daily calorie defiecency of 300, which will bring you closer to your ideal weight. nutritiondata.com and caloriesburnedperhour.com are good sights to figure out what foods are healthy nutrition/calorie wise and how much you burn from exercise. does it matter where the calories come from?

i count calories always and the fat content, but at times i want to eat a packet of walkers crisp 95kcal so instead of 2 crackers or cereal bar could i have that and not gain weight. Alpen light bars are 60kcal and tasty so is it ok to vary your intake of food and have low calorie foods like popcorn 38kcal, jelly sugar free hartleys less than 10kcal.
oh yes i am obsessed with food but don't want to go back not to eating.


It does but you don't have to be perfectly counting every single calorie. I mean what the hell is "38 calories" for popcorn anyway? What fool said it was /exactly/ 38 calories? It really varies, I always round up those weird numbers (38 = 40). It's perfectly fine to eat a bag of crisps instead of instead of crackers or light bars. Your body is probably used to processing the cerealbars/crackers, so some crips will be a nice little shock for it to handle. When you keep eating the same foods over and over again, that's one of those things that makes people gain weight, especially when it's junkfood with no nutrition. But seriously, one bag of crisps instead of a cereal bar won't make you fat at all :) It's when you eat 9 a day you should start worrying.

not losing weight - what am i doing wrong?

ok i eat healthy - well i think it is a typical day i have :-

2 weetbix with skimmed milk
1 cup of tea 1/4 teaspoon of sugar

mid morning - banana

lunch - a salad with light salad crem or a fruit salad -3 pieces of fruit

mid after - cup of green tea
snack - hand full of japanese rice crackers - or walkers lite pkt crisps

dinner - plate of steamed veg - with either fish fingers - or a quorn burger

a cup of green tea

drink bout 1 litre of water

excercise - 3 x 30mins fast walking everyday - and 2 x 1 hours aerobic classes a week.

i've been doing for 3 weeks and haven't lose a pound.(i'm 5ft and weight 9 stones and 6Ibs)

any seriuos suggestions would be grateful


I would say you're doing everything right....just give it a little longer!

3 weeks isn't long to see results. With exercise, they always say you start to see good results after 6 weeks.
